Mary Shelley plot

"Her greatest love inspired her darkest creation"

Mary is a rebellious, outspoken teenager. When she meets the poet Percy Shelley, sparks fly between the two outsiders who feel trapped in polite society. When Mary's family discovers that Percy is married and has a child, they forbid all contact. Mary and Percy then flee, taking Mary's half-sister Claire with them. It's a big scandal and with Percy's flirtatious ways, rumors of a ménage à trois quickly spread.

What a disappointment!

The first female director from Saudi Arabia will film a biography of a woman who, at the age of 18 on New Year's Day 1818 (exactly 200 years ago), wrote a great story that is still used as a metaphor for the risks of 'change' and of 'progress'.

I sat down and was so curious about her view from her Eastern culture on this Western icon: student Frankenstein creates a monster that he rejects and who then tries to survive alone in a hostile culture. How many ingredients do you need to weave a contemporary view into a historical context?

Forget it. Before the film starts, you spend three minutes looking at logos of all the producers who all wanted to pee. Afterwards you will read that Al-Mansour has updated the screenplay. It was of no avail.

The film is a Western romance dragon of the first order that neatly rattles off all known facts and leaves you as a spectator with a highly unsatisfied feeling. A picture book, neatly decorated, occasionally naughty, and that was it.

Bloody hell. Her film Wadjda was so subtly moving critically...
